Sowore/Dasuki release: The act by FG was to set an example that it adheres to the rule of law – Presidency

The Senior Special Assistant to the President on Media and Publicity, Mr. Garba Shehu, said President Muhammadu Buhari’s administration ordered the release of Sambo Dasuki and Omoyele Sowore despite not agreeing to the verdict of the court.

According to Garba  who spoke during an interview with Channels Television’s Politics Today on Wednesday,the act by the Federal Government was to set an important example to the world that it adheres to the rule of law.

“The government is not compromising anything. The government wants to set an important example of obedience to the law even when you disagree with what the court says you should do,” he said.

While Dasuki was arrested in December 2015, Sowore was rearrested on December 5 after his initial arrest on August 5.

Although both men regained their freedom on Tuesday, the Attorney General of Justice and Minister of Justice, Abubakar Malami, said the release was in compliance with subsisting court orders.
